Output 64baf5b5d1abbd31fa09d81003f5c1ed4538ada9bf7befa5c343658791e2bbb8:8
- value
- 535608696
- script pubkey
- OP_0 OP_PUSHBYTES_32 de37c45b0bab00a666321470f10570d9a60ca1456ebc791ca9811bae3c56e42b
- address
- bc1qmcmugkct4vq2ve3jz3c0zptsmxnqeg29d678j89fsyd6u0zkus4swjdkkn
- transaction
- 64baf5b5d1abbd31fa09d81003f5c1ed4538ada9bf7befa5c343658791e2bbb8